Sprout to Growth: Scaling Quantum Startups with Impact
The quantum computing revolution is upon us, and startups are at the forefront of this revolutionary change. These entrepreneurs are pushing the boundaries of what's possible, developing solutions that have the potential to revolutionize industries from manufacturing. But scaling a quantum startup is no easy feat. It requires a unique combination of technical expertise, operational savvy, and a unwavering passion to impact.
There are several key factors that contribute to the success of scaling quantum startups. First, it's crucial to recruit top talent. Quantum computing is a highly specialized field, so finding scientists with the necessary skills and experience is essential. Second, startups need to develop strong partnerships with universities, research institutions, and industry leaders. These collaborations can provide access to cutting-edge infrastructure and help accelerate innovation.
Third, it's important for quantum startups to clearly define their target market and develop a strong value proposition. What unique problem are they addressing? How is their solution better than existing alternatives? Finally, startups need to secure the necessary investment to support their growth. This can come from a variety of sources, including venture capitalists, angel investors, and government grants.
By focusing on these key factors, quantum startups can increase their chances of success. The potential rewards are enormous: revolutionizing industries, creating new jobs, and solving some of the world's most pressing challenges.
